Challenges in Intercultural Dialogue
While cultural exchange offers immense benefits, it also presents challenges:
- Language barriers: Differences in language can hinder effective communication and understanding.
- Cultural misunderstandings: Misinterpreting cultural cues or gestures can lead to misunderstandings and conflict.
- Ethnocentrism: The tendency to view one's own culture as superior to others can hinder open and respectful dialogue.
- Power imbalances: Historical or political factors can create unequal power dynamics that affect intercultural interactions.
